Merge branch 'net-phy-remove-phy_driver_is_genphy-and-phy_driver_is_genphy_10g'
Heiner Kallweit says: ==================== net: phy: remove phy_driver_is_genphy and phy_driver_is_genphy_10g Replace phy_driver_is_genphy() and phy_driver_is_genphy_10g() with a new flag in struct phy_device. ==================== Link: https://patch.msgid.link/5778e86e-dd54-4388-b824-6132729ad481@gmail.com Signed-off-by: Jakub Kicinski <kuba@kernel.org>
